What is Shopify?
Shopify is a leading e-commerce platform enabling businesses to create online stores and manage sales across multiple channels. It provides a comprehensive suite of tools for everything from website design and product listings to inventory management and secure payments [3]. Merchants use Shopify to quickly launch and scale their online presence, adapting to evolving digital marketplaces and consumer behaviors.
How does Shopify adapt to AI in e-commerce?
Shopify is rapidly integrating with AI advancements to ensure merchant visibility and competitiveness. Optimizing your store for AI shopping agents like ChatGPT is crucial, as AI prioritizes structured data over descriptive text [1]. This ensures your products are discoverable and purchasable directly within AI chat interfaces, highlighting the platform's strategic agility in leveraging new technologies [2].
What metrics matter for Shopify store growth?
Growing a Shopify store requires a strategic approach beyond just sales. Key metrics often involve understanding customer acquisition costs, conversion rates, and lifetime value. Additionally, maintaining a sustainable work-life balance is implicitly linked to long-term business health, as highlighted in discussions around e-commerce discipline [2]. For optimal results, analyze factors like site traffic, bounce rates, and average order value to continually refine your strategy.
